Chemical etching is a versatile and precise technique used to create intricate designs on metal surfaces This process involves using chemicals to selectively remove material from a metal sheet, leaving behind a decorative or functional pattern From custom signage to industrial parts, chemical etching offers limitless possibilities for creating unique and high-quality metal products.
The process of chemical etching begins with preparing the metal surface The metal sheet is cleaned and degreased to ensure that the chemicals can effectively remove the desired areas A resist material, such as a film or a liquid coating, is then applied to the metal surface This resist acts as a barrier, protecting the areas that are not intended to be etched.
Next, a chemical solution, typically an acid, is applied to the metal surface The acid selectively eats away at the exposed areas of the metal, leaving behind the desired design The depth of the etching can be controlled by adjusting the concentration of the chemical solution and the duration of the etching process This allows for the creation of fine details and intricate patterns on the metal surface.
One of the key advantages of chemical etching is its ability to produce precise and consistent results Unlike traditional methods of metal engraving or stamping, chemical etching can achieve intricate designs with sharp edges and fine lines This makes it ideal for applications where high precision and accuracy are required, such as in the production of electronic components or medical devices.

The process does not require expensive tooling or dies, making it a more affordable option for producing small quantities or prototypes This versatility makes chemical etching an attractive choice for businesses looking to create custom metal parts without incurring high upfront costs.
In addition to its precision and cost-effectiveness, chemical etching offers a wide range of design possibilities The design options are virtually limitless, from simple logos and text to complex patterns and graphics This flexibility allows for the creation of unique and eye-catching metal products that stand out from the crowd.
Chemical etching is commonly used in a variety of industries, including aerospace, automotive, electronics, and jewelry In the aerospace industry, chemical etching is used to create intricate parts for aircraft engines and components In the automotive industry, it is used to produce custom emblems and badges for vehicles In the electronics industry, chemical etching is used to create circuit boards and other electrical components And in the jewelry industry, it is used to design intricate patterns and textures on metal surfaces.
